The Young Men of America: A Sparkling Journal for Young Ladies and Gentleman
This collection consists of a tabloid-sized story paper on newsprint entitled The Young Men of America dated August 23, 1888, Vol. XL, No. 572. It contains a number of serialized children's stories with illustrations, with Davy Crockett, Jr. on the front page. It also contains short factual articles, letters to the editor, and advertisements on the back page.

Biographical/Historical Note
The Young Men of America was a children's story paper published in New York by Frank Tousey from 1888 to 1889. Frank Tousey published other, similar papers and dime novels.
